1. The Oven Gives You a Crispy Base
The biggest reason to make a pizza bagel in the oven is the crispy texture you get on the bottom and edges.
When you bake a pizza bagel in the oven, the heat directly hits the exposed bread, which draws out moisture and creates a crunchy foundation.
This is something the microwave completely fails at because it steams the bread, leaving your pizza bagel in the oven looking sad and chewy.
So if you want that bakery-style crunch, you’ve got to use the oven method.
2. Even Cheese Melting Without Burning
Another perk of learning how to make a pizza bagel in the oven is that the cheese melts more predictably.
The oven’s ambient heat surrounds the bagel from all sides, so the cheese gets gooey while the sauce stays warm and the bagel doesn’t burn.
You can even turn on the broiler for the last minute to get those delightful brown spots on the cheese, which adds a ton of flavor.

The Step-by-Step Guide to Making a Pizza Bagel in the Oven
Now that you know why the oven is the way to go, let’s walk through the exact process of how to make a pizza bagel in the oven from start to finish.
Follow these simple steps, and you’ll have perfect pizza bagels in no time.
Step 1: Choose Your Bagels and Prep Them
To make a pizza bagel in the oven, you’ll want fresh bagels, though day-old ones work great too.
Plain, everything, or garlic bagels all taste amazing, so pick your favorite.
Slice each bagel in half horizontally so you have two flat rounds.
If you want an extra crispy base, you can toast the bagel halves lightly before adding toppings, but this is completely optional.
Step 2: Add the Sauce
The next step in how to make a pizza bagel in the oven is spreading a thin layer of pizza sauce on each cut side.
You can use jarred marinara, homemade pizza sauce, or even plain tomato paste mixed with Italian herbs.
Don’t go overboard with the sauce, as too much liquid will make your pizza bagel in the oven turn out soggy.
A couple of tablespoons per half is usually the sweet spot.
Step 3: Layer on the Cheese
After the sauce, it’s time for the star of the show, the cheese.
Shredded mozzarella is the classic choice, but you can also mix in provolone, cheddar, or even a sprinkle of parmesan for extra flavor.
When you make a pizza bagel in the oven, you want to cover the sauce completely with cheese, reaching right to the edges so you get that delicious cheese crisp.
Step 4: Add Your Favorite Toppings
This is where you get creative with your pizza bagel in the oven.
Pepperoni, cooked sausage, mushrooms, bell peppers, olives, and onions are all fantastic options.
Just make sure any raw toppings like peppers or mushrooms are sliced thin so they cook through in the oven.
If you’re using pepperoni, you can add it on top of the cheese or underneath it, depending on how crispy you like it.
Step 5: Bake to Perfection
Preheat your oven to 400°F (200°C) and line a baking sheet with parchment paper or foil.
Place the prepared pizza bagels on the sheet, leaving a little space between each one.
Bake for about 10 to 12 minutes, or until the cheese is melted and the edges of the bagel are golden brown.
For a bubbly, browned top, switch to broil for the final 1 to 2 minutes, but keep a close eye on them so they don’t burn.
Once they’re done, let them cool for a minute or two before digging in.

1. Don’t Overload the Toppings
While it’s tempting to pile on everything, too many toppings can make your pizza bagel in the oven heavy and greasy.
Stick to one or two main toppings plus cheese, and you’ll get a balanced bite every time.
2. Use a Wire Rack for Extra Crispiness
If you really want a crispy bottom when you make a pizza bagel in the oven, place the bagels on a wire cooling rack set over the baking sheet.
This allows hot air to circulate underneath, preventing sogginess from trapped steam.
